Output 34f3ca764a1fa42ae85c52a7629e7c609019b194cd81a9c8c53f59cb8dc15387:11

value
151097
script pubkey
OP_0 OP_PUSHBYTES_20 d75e19e8437ca30ca475307ec3637d4b6fb799ec
address
bc1q6a0pn6zr0j3sefr4xplvxcmafdhm0x0vp28hcj
transaction
34f3ca764a1fa42ae85c52a7629e7c609019b194cd81a9c8c53f59cb8dc15387
spent
true